> On Wed, May 18, 2011 at 8:55 AM, Michael Sumner <mdsumner at gmail.com> wrote:
>> See under "Note" in ?strptime:
>>    Remember that in most timezones some times do not occur and some
>>      occur twice because of transitions to/from summer time.
>>      ‘strptime’ does not validate such times (it does not assume a
>>      specific timezone), but conversion by ‘as.POSIXct’) will do so.

>>> I have a problem with duplicated date_time stamps that I do not see as
>>> duplicated.
>>> 
>>> I read a file with observations taken every 30 minutes:
>>> 
>>>> 
>>>> aur2009=read.csv(paste(datadir,"AUR_ECPP_2009.csv",sep="/"),sep=";",stringsAsFactors=F)
>>>> aur2009[1:3,1:5]
>>>      Date.Time E_filled E_filled_flag LE_filled LE_filled_flag
>>> 1 1/1/2009 0:00        0           NaN      5.86            NaN
>>> 2 1/1/2009 0:30        0           NaN      5.05            NaN
>>> 3 1/1/2009 1:00        0           NaN      5.56            NaN
>>> 
>>>> delme = strptime(aur2009[,1], "%m/%d/%Y %H:%M")
>>>> aur2009[,1]=as.POSIXct(delme)
>>>            Date.Time E_filled E_filled_flag LE_filled LE_filled_flag
>>> 1 2009-01-01 00:00:00        0           NaN      5.86            NaN
>>> 2 2009-01-01 00:30:00        0           NaN      5.05            NaN
>>> 3 2009-01-01 01:00:00        0           NaN      5.56            NaN
>>> 
>>>> aur2009ts = ts(aur2009)
>>>> row.names(aur2009ts) = as.character(delme)
>>>> aur2009ts[1:3,1:5]
>>>                     Date.Time E_filled E_filled_flag LE_filled
>>> LE_filled_flag
>>> 2009-01-01 00:00:00 1230764400        0           NaN      5.86
>>>  NaN
>>> 2009-01-01 00:30:00 1230766200        0           NaN      5.05
>>>  NaN
>>> 2009-01-01 01:00:00 1230768000        0           NaN      5.56
>>>  NaN
>>> 
>>> Then:
>>>> aur2009z = zoo(aur2009[,2:12],as.POSIXct(delme))
>>> Warning message:
>>> In zoo(aur2009[, 2:12], as.POSIXct(delme)) :
>>>  some methods for “zoo” objects do not work if the index entries in
>>> ‘order.by’ are not unique
>>> 
>>> So I investigate:
>>>> any(duplicated(aur2009ts[,1]))
>>> [1] TRUE
>>> 
>>>> aur2009ts[(duplicated(aur2009ts[,1])),1:5]
>>>                     Date.Time E_filled E_filled_flag LE_filled
>>> LE_filled_flag
>>> 2009-03-29 02:00:00 1238284800        0           NaN       1.2
>>>  NaN
>>> 2009-03-29 02:30:00 1238286600        0           NaN       1.2
>>>  NaN
>>> 
>>> But note the surprise:
>>>> aur2009ts[aur2009ts[,1]==1238284800,1:5]
>>>                     Date.Time E_filled E_filled_flag LE_filled
>>> LE_filled_flag
>>> 2009-03-29 01:00:00 1238284800        0           NaN     -0.58
>>>  NaN
>>> 2009-03-29 02:00:00 1238284800        0           NaN      1.20
>>>  NaN
>>>> aur2009ts[aur2009ts[,1]==1238286600,1:5]
>>>                     Date.Time E_filled E_filled_flag LE_filled
>>> LE_filled_flag
>>> 2009-03-29 01:30:00 1238286600        0           NaN     -0.34
>>>  NaN
>>> 2009-03-29 02:30:00 1238286600        0           NaN      1.20
>>>  NaN
>>> 
>>> The dates detected as duplicated are actually different times that got
>>> the same value in the ts version of the object!
>>> What am I doing wrong? They are all observations every 30min, why are
>>> these 2 encoded as the
>>> same time?
